        Dr Carina Ginty is a Head of Teaching and Learning at ATU with responsibility for Education Innovation & Transformation. In February 2025, Carina was awarded a Principal Fellowship with Advance HE (PFHEA).

        Carina is the Atlantic Technological University (ATU) lead for N-TUTORR Transforming Learning and the N-TUTORR TU sector co-lead student empowerment. Funded by NextGenerationEU (value 40 million euro), the aim of this ambitious program focuses on transforming teaching, learning and assessment through student empowerment, building staff capabilities and developing the digital ecosystem in technological universities in Ireland.

        Working in higher education for 20 years, Carina is a leader in teaching and learning innovation at ATU and has initiated various national and international innovation projects in teaching, learning and assessment enhancement, digital transformation, digital pedagogies, student engagement and leadership.

        From 2019-2022 Carina led the development of DigitalEd.ie, a knowledge platform to build digital teaching and learning capabilities across all campuses of the ATU under iNOTE funded by the HEA innovation fund. In ATU, Carina is also co-leading in the HigherEd 4.0 project on the development of a career and learning pathway platform called MyCareerPath.ie, that is transforming access pathways to higher education.

        Carina is chair of the Learning, Teaching and Assessment Committee of Academic Council. She is a member of the EU Green Alliance Education Commission and is leading a team tasked with coordinating the professional and pedagogical development programme for 9 EU university partners.

        In 2022, Carina was awarded the President’s Award for Outstanding Institutional Citizenship.
